Hanley Dawson Cadillac and Lawry's restaurant
View looking northwest along East Ontario Street. The Hanley Dawson Cadillac dealership (now demolished) stands on the block between North Rush Street and North Wabash Avenue. Lawry's restaurant, at the northeast corner of East Ontario and North Rush Streets, is partially visible on the right.
1976
Industrial buildings, West Ontario Street
View of the rear of industrial buildings on West Ontario Street, west of North Orleans Street, facing the Ohio-Ontario Feeder ramp. On the left of the image is the Ontario Building (now Ontario Street Lofts, 411 West Ontario Street), for sale at the time of the photograph. Next to it on the right is 369 West Ontario, with the words Artcrest Suspended Ceilings painted on it. To its right is 401 West Ontario Street, with a billboard on its side facade announcing "The condominiums are here, The condominiums are here".
1978
West Huron and North Wells Streets
View looking southwest across West Huron Street from just east of the intersection with North Wells Street. The parking lot in the foreground, located along the east side of North Wells Street between West Huron and West Erie Streets, is still in existence (2017). A billboard in that parking lot advertises Newport cigarettes. To the left behind the billboard, the yellow and turquoise exterior of Ed Debevic's restaurant (640 North Wells Street, demolished) is visible. To the right of the billboard, the three story building with the brown brick front facade became part of the Hooters restaurant at 660 North Wells Street. Behind this building is North Branch II (311-313 West Superior Street), with a banner reading "The North Branch Center". The Merchandise Mart is in the distance at the far left.
1985
John Sexton Building from Hubbard Street
View of the John Sexton Building, looking northwest from the intersection of West Hubbard Street and North Orleans Street. Hubbard Street is in the foreground at the bottom of the photograph, and a large parking lot occupies that block. The Wallace Press Building is partially visible on the far left side of the photograph.
1978

Assumption Catholic Church
View looking southeast across West Illinois Street from the intersection with North Orleans Street. Assumption Catholic Church (323 West Illinois Street) is in the foreground on the right. On the far left side of the photograph, 225 West Illinois Street/445 North Franklin Street is visible, with Marina City behind it to the right.
1976
Rear of Orleans-Huron Building, 325 West Huron Street
View looking northeast from the intersection of North Orleans and West Erie Streets, towards the rear of the Orleans-Huron Building, a concrete-framed eight story warehouse at 325 West Huron Street. A Shell gas station (demolished) occupies the northeast corner of West Erie Street and North Orleans Street.
1978
Elevated train tracks, North Franklin Street
View looking south along North Franklin Street towards the intersection with West Kinzie Street and the Merchandise Mart. The CTA Brown Line elevated tracks run above the street. 300 West Hubbard is partially visible on the far right side of the image; the intersection with West Hubbard Street is in the middle ground.
1978

East Ohio Street between Rush Street and Michigan Avenue
View of the office and commercial buildings on the north side of East Ohio Street on the block between and North Rush Street and North Michigan Avenue. The Corner House restaurant and the Just Pants clothing store occupy the ground floor of the 100 East Ohio Street building (demolished). Next to it on the right, a cocktail lounge occupies the ground floor of another office building.
1976
Apartment houses and businesses on North State Street
View along the west side of North State Street, looking north from West Ontario Street. On the left are dilapidated nineteenth-century apartments with street-level retail businesses. On the right is the Dana Hotel at 666 North State Street (demolished). The top part of the Lawson House YMCA building (Victor F. Lawson YMCA) located at 30 West Chicago Avenue, is visible in the background.
1976
